Beschreibung
Zusammenfassung:In the current thesis several selected aspects of the two related latent class models; finite mixtures and hidden Markov models, were considered. The problem of calculating the MLE of a Gaussian mixture with Newton's method and the consistency of penalized MLE were investigated. A penalized MLE procedure for univariate Gaussian hidden Markov models was introduced and shown to be consistent. Furthermore, a result on identifiability of nonparametric hidden Markov models is derived.
